This report analyzed 3 schools in New Jersey to see which ones offered the best value master's degree programs for math students. The goal was to highlight schools with more affordable prices than others offering similar quality experiences.
This ranking is not just a list of inexpensive schools. We also consider each school's quality, since we believe a low-quality school may not be a 'bargain' at any price. More specifically, we discount our quality score by the published tuition and fees charged by a school.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The value is determined by how much quality your dollar buys.
For nationwide and regional rankings, we use out-of-state tuition and fees in our calculations. Average in-state tuition and fees are used for our statewide rankings.

Best New Jersey Schools for Affordable Quality for a Master's in Mathematics
Our 2023 rankings named Montclair State University the best value school in New Jersey for mathematics students working on their master’s degree. Located in the large suburb of Montclair, Montclair State is a public college with a very large student population.
Montclair State graduate students pay an average of $13,519 in in-state tuition and fees each year.

The excellent master’s degree programs at Rowan University helped the school earn the #2 place on this year’s ranking of the best value mathematics schools in New Jersey. Rowan is a fairly large public school located in the suburb of Glassboro.
Rowan graduate students pay an average of $16,146 in in-state tuition and fees each year.

A rank of #3 on this year’s list means Rutgers University - New Brunswick is a great value for mathematics students working on their master’s degree. Rutgers New Brunswick is a very large public school located in the small city of New Brunswick.
Rutgers New Brunswick graduate students pay an average of $20,495 in in-state tuition and fees each year.
